Hello plugin authors,

Next Thursday, Corbexa will run a disaster-recovery drill for the RestockRoute vending-machine restock planner. During the failover window, plugin callbacks will be replayed against the standby scheduler, so please ensure your handlers are idempotent and tolerate duplicate route assignments. No customer restock data will be altered. To re-register your plugin against the standby environment during the drill, authenticate with the recovery passphrase provided below.

vault phrase of hahip-tajeg = quenax-briath-briax

## Tuning

Droptail's webhook dispatcher retries each delivery with capped exponential backoff and full jitter. Reviewers should check that any change to these values keeps the total retry horizon under the dead-letter deadline, and that jitter remains proportional to the base interval to avoid synchronized retry storms. The constants currently shipped as defaults are as follows.

tuning constants:
QUOTAS = {
    "druwyn": 5,
    "holix": 5,
    "zorath": 5,
    "holwyn": 10,
}

SDK Parity — Who to Contact

New to the Fernwick platform team? Here's how parity questions get routed. The Kotlin SDK (Bramblekit) and the Swift SDK (Thistlekit) are maintained by separate squads, and feature parity is tracked on the Parity Board, reviewed every second Tuesday. If you spot a gap, file a parity ticket first — do not patch one SDK unilaterally, as that creates drift. Escalations go to the SDK stewardship rotation, led this quarter by Odette Varn. You can reach the rotation directly below.

pager mailbox: silael.sorwyn.tamius@zemvarsys.corp